Hunza Valley Trekking Routes for Beginners

Hunza Valley offers some of Pakistan's most accessible mountain scenery. These routes suit beginners with basic fitness — no technical climbing required.

1. Eagle's Nest Viewpoint (Duiker)

A short drive or moderate hike from Karimabad rewards you with panoramic views of Rakaposhi, Ultar Sar, and the valley floor. Best at sunrise or sunset. Allow 1–2 hours at the viewpoint.

2. Baltit Fort to Altit Fort Walk

Cultural walking route between two historic forts above Karimabad. Paved paths in sections; comfortable shoes sufficient. Combine with a guided fort tour.

3. Attabad Lake Shore

Flat lakeside paths near the turquoise Attabad Lake. Easy for families. Boat rides available in season.

4. Nagar Valley Day Walks

Hopper Glacier viewpoint trails near Nagar are slightly more demanding — hire a local guide for glacier approaches.

Safety for Beginners

  • Altitude: Karimabad is ~2,500 m — move slowly, drink water, watch for headaches
  • Weather changes fast — pack a rain layer even in summer
  • Hire licensed local guides for anything beyond marked paths
  • Register your plans with your hotel

Best Season

April–October for clear trails. Winter snow makes higher paths difficult without equipment.
